How 30461 compares

ZIP 30461 is one of the pricier ZIP codes in Statesboro: its typical home value of $317,000 ranks #1 of the 4 Statesboro ZIP codes we track (the citywide range runs from $196,000 in 30446 to $317,000 in 30461). Per square foot it costs about $168, against $182 for Statesboro as a whole, $175 for Georgia, and $195 nationally.

Salary needed to buy a home in ZIP 30461

To buy the typical $317,000 home in ZIP 30461 with 20% down, you need a household income of roughly $86,000 a year (about $2,010 a month for the mortgage, taxes, and insurance). With 10% down the bar rises to about $102,000, because the loan is bigger and mortgage insurance kicks in.

Down paymentCash downMonthly paymentIncome needed
5% (+PMI)$15,900$2,500/mo$107,000/yr
10% (+PMI)$31,700$2,390/mo$102,000/yr
20%$63,400$2,010/mo$86,000/yr

Assumes a 30-year fixed mortgage at 6.5%, property tax at 1.1% and insurance at 0.45% of value per year, PMI of 0.75% on loans with less than 20% down, and the standard 28% housing-to-income rule. Your rate, taxes, and HOA will move these — run your own numbers in the mortgage calculator.
